
Doors, Windows & Glazing in Hull
Hull's housing is dominated by interwar and postwar terraces and semis, with a large amount of consistent council-built stock. Standard opening sizes make replacement work efficient, though older stock around the Old Town needs heritage-grade detailing.
Working on Properties in Hull
Coastal-influence and Humber exposure mean higher-spec gaskets and hardware are sensible on properties close to the estuary. Hull Old Town and parts of the Avenues sit in conservation areas. Replacements are designed to Hull City Council guidance.
Buy-to-let conversions and HMOs often need glazing that meets specific fire-egress and security criteria — we handle the spec, not just the fitting.
Where scaffolding is needed (typically for above-bay or dormer windows), we coordinate access dates rather than passing that headache to the customer.
Hull's Humber estuary position brings cold east winds, dampness and salt air.
